Love Streams

  • Dir: John Cassavetes

  • USA, 1984, English, 141mins, DCP

  • Cast: Gena Rowlands, John Cassavetes, Seymour Cassel

The Cassavetes-Rowlands final collaboration sees their perpetual inquiry into the nature of love and bondage in its most mighty and intimate form. Playing brother and sister, they give shimmering, delicate performances as two closely bound, emotionally wounded souls. Reunited after years apart, he is now a boozy, middle-aged writer living among a parade of hookers, and she is a divorced woman struggling to hang on to her husband, daughter and sanity, both searching for warmth and selfdefinition. Intoxicating and perilous, fusing sober realism and surreal flourishes, Love Streams is a bravely self-searching summation of a career, an era and a life.

Berlin International Film Festival: Golden Bear for Best Film and FIPRESCI Prize
